This news is based on the following article: Huang M, Jiao J, Zhuang P, Chen X, Wang J, Zhang Y. Serum polyfluoroalkyl chemicals are associated with risk of cardiovascular diseases in national US population. Environ Int 2018 ; 119 : 37-46. doi : 10.1016/j.envint.2018.05.051
This analysis of data from the National Health and Nutrition Examination Survey (NHANES) suggests an association between exposure to perfluoroalkyl substances (PFAS) and cardiovascular disease. The authors call for further study to help explain this association.
